Westerfield #10158 is the latest M&StL kit. This models the 29000 series of used cars the M&StL had from about 1939 to 1948. I will be up in Iowa for another...
These are double sheath box cars with steel ends. I made a model of this series. See at: http://www.eldora.net/lyndon/propst/mstl29048.html Clark Propst Mason...

The 29000 series box cars were originally door and a half box cars built following a 1916 NYC design. Many were rebuilt to single door cars and went to the...
